About the Author

Elliott Kalb is "Mr. Stats" at ESPN, TNT, and HBO. Formerly with NBC for 15 years, Kalb is a five time Emmy winner and a one-time writer for the greatest play-by-play announcer in baseball history, Vin Scully

Books of sports lists can be exasperating, this one especially so. To begin with, like sports anthologies, their content's interest level for a given reader will be only so great as their interest in the sport under discussion at the moment. This book complicates that problem with the peg on which it stands, viz., the author's rating each conspiracy on a scale of one to five "Oswalts" (as in Lee). This undoubtedly seemed like a good idea at the time, but the ratings too often don't match his narration of the affair; for example, after going on for twenty pages about how the first NBA draft lottery was rigged, with nary a dissenting voice, he gives it his lowest rating for credibility. All of the words are spelled correctly, but the names are butchered, start to finish, often to the point of multiple spellings on the same page. And, oddly, the final five chapters are written (and much better) by somebody else. This book is entertaining, and at times informative, but for the most part if you were interested in these scandals beforehand, you've probably read as much as you need to to form your own opinion anyway.… (more)
